
Middle Bronze Age I
Red Polished Juglet
Pottery juglet in Red Polished III ware; hand-made; globular body with rounded base and short concave neck with spouted cutaway rim; handle from neck to shoulder; deeply incised with concentric circles, parallel strokes, dots and wavy-lines with no obvious trace of lime fill; slipped and polished but surface very worn; intact. Dimensions: Height: 11.30 centimetres Object Type: jug Ware: Red Polished Ware (RP III) Series: Stewart Type (I A3 type c var. b); Red Polished III Techniques: handmade; incised; slipped; polished
Date
1950 - 1850 BC
Accession No.
1868,0905.23
Collection
British Museum
Provenance
- Dhali
